啟動后,catalina.out日志中會有如下打印:
INFO: Creation of SecureRandom instance for session ID generation using [SHA1PRNG] took [608,678] milliseconds
具體原因,有興趣的可以自己百度一下“Tomcat SecureRandom”。
解決辦法如下:
在${tomcat}/bin/setenv.sh中,添加如下項:
JAVA_OPTS="-Djava.security.egd=file:/dev/./urandom"
重新啟動tomcat,很快就可以啟動了。